Select HP Photosmart cameras include exclusive HP video print technology that lets
you capture VGA video up to 30 frames per second, plus the ability to select a single
video frame to save as a separate still image.

HP video print gives you a new way to use your camera to capture important moments
in your life. No computer is required to use this feature!

|
 |
HP uses special image
processing techniques to extract a frame from the
video, improve the quality, reduce MPEG artifacts,
and create a still image from any frame in the video.
Because the photo is based on video which is captured
at lower resolution, it will look best when printed
as a 3x5 or 4x6 photo. |

How to
capture a frame |
 |

To use the video print feature, follow these simple steps.

 |
 |
| 1. |
Make sure your camera's video quality is
set to VGA***, then capture your video clip. |
|
 |
 |
 |
| 2. |
Switch to playback mode, and press "OK" to
pause the video when you see a part you want to capture as a still photo. |
|
 |
 |
 |
| 3. |
Press the right/left arrows on the 4-way
controller to find precisely the frame you want. Then press the "up" arrow
button to extract the frame and, in less than 5 seconds, create the
still image. The new photo will be stored in your camera as a new image. |
